Best Foods to Gain Weight
Choosing the best foods to gain weight can help you increase calorie intake while providing essential nutrients.
1. Nuts and Nut Butters
Almonds, peanuts, cashews, and peanut butter are excellent weight gain foods because they are rich in healthy fats, protein, and calories.
2. Whole Milk and Dairy Products
Milk, yogurt, cheese, and paneer are healthy weight gain foods that provide protein, calcium, and calories to support muscle growth.
3. Rice and Whole Grains
Rice, oats, quinoa, and whole wheat products are effective foods for weight gain because they provide energy and support muscle recovery.
4. Eggs
Eggs are one of the best protein rich foods for weight gain. They contain high-quality protein and healthy fats that support muscle development.
5. Avocados
Avocados are among the healthiest high calorie foods for weight gain because they provide healthy fats, vitamins, and minerals.

Weight Gain Meal Plan Example
A simple weight gain meal plan can help you increase calorie intake consistently.
Breakfast
Oatmeal with milk, nuts, and bananas
Mid-Morning Snack
Peanut butter sandwich and fruit
Lunch
Chicken, rice, and vegetables
Afternoon Snack
Greek yogurt with nuts
Dinner
Paneer or fish with sweet potatoes
Before Bed
Milk and a handful of almonds
This balanced muscle gain meal plan provides calories, protein, and nutrients to support both muscle growth and weight gain.
Weight Gain Tips for Long-Term Success
Following practical weight gain tips can help you achieve sustainable results:
Eat More Frequently
Aim for 5–6 meals throughout the day.
Prioritize Protein
Include protein rich foods for weight gain in every meal.
Choose Calorie-Dense Foods
Add healthy high calorie foods for weight gain such as nuts, avocados, and dairy products.
Strength Train Regularly
Resistance training helps convert extra calories into muscle.
Be Consistent
Healthy weight gain takes time and patience.
